草庐IT

ESP32-CAM入门教程

ESP32-CAM入门教程1.材料ArduinoESP32-CAM下载模块(接上USB就能用,很方便,如果没有买就只有资金用USB-TTL了)如下图两个合在一起如下图2.Arduino+ESP32开发环境搭建官网下载Arduinohttps://www.arduino.cc/en/software(建议不要下载beta版,可能会有问题)如果官网太慢可以在这里下载Arduino中文社区-PoweredbyDiscuz!)安装ESP32开发包,文件->首选项->附加开发板管理器输入https://dl.espressif.com/dl/package_esp32_index.json然后重启Ard

常见摄像头接口USB、DVP、MIPI接口的对比

常见摄像头接口DVP、MIPI、USB的比较引言摄像头传感器已经广泛用于嵌入式设备了,现在的手机很多都支持多个摄像头。在物联网领域,摄像头传感器也越来越被广泛使用。今天就来简单聊一聊几种常见的摄像头接口。传感器与主控设备进行通信,是设备-设备之间的通信,几乎所有的设备间通信都需要约定传输数据的时序,即什么时间(或者说速率)按什么格式传输数据。设备间通信主要使用同步、异步通信两种方式。典型的同步通信比如I2C、异步通信如USART。同步通信的典型特点是有时钟信号总线完成两个设备的数据同步,比如常见的I2C、SPI通信都有SCL/CLK时钟线:异步通信的典型特点是没有时钟信号总线,两个设备之间提前

常见摄像头接口USB、DVP、MIPI接口的对比

常见摄像头接口DVP、MIPI、USB的比较引言摄像头传感器已经广泛用于嵌入式设备了,现在的手机很多都支持多个摄像头。在物联网领域,摄像头传感器也越来越被广泛使用。今天就来简单聊一聊几种常见的摄像头接口。传感器与主控设备进行通信,是设备-设备之间的通信,几乎所有的设备间通信都需要约定传输数据的时序,即什么时间(或者说速率)按什么格式传输数据。设备间通信主要使用同步、异步通信两种方式。典型的同步通信比如I2C、异步通信如USART。同步通信的典型特点是有时钟信号总线完成两个设备的数据同步,比如常见的I2C、SPI通信都有SCL/CLK时钟线:异步通信的典型特点是没有时钟信号总线,两个设备之间提前

【历史上的今天】7 月 31 日:“缸中之脑”的提出者诞生;Wi-Fi 之父出生;USB 3.1 标准发布

整理|王启隆透过「历史上的今天」,从过去看未来,从现在亦可以改变未来。今天是2023年7月31日,在1971年的今天,人类首次完成了月球车的行驶。这一天,“阿波罗15”号的宇航员戴维斯·斯科特和詹姆斯·欧文进行了人类首次月球车行驶,他们驾驶着4轮月球车,在崎岖不平的月球表面上,越过陨石坑和砾石行驶了数公里。斯科特和欧文成为在月球上漫步的第7位和第8位人,而且是第一个在月球上驾车行驶的人。回顾计算机历史,7月31日这一天还发生过哪些关键事件呢?1926年7月31日:计算机哲学家HilaryPutnam出生1926年7月31日,哲学家、数学家与计算机科学家希拉里·普特南(HilaryPutnam)

usb_cam安装包相关问题

这里的话是基于很多人的文档,就不一一说明了,自己在做的时候还是有很多问题没有解决1.安装相关的功能包:sudoapt-getinstallros-kinetic-uvc-camera上面这个是针对的UVC,我们一般使用的是USB,所以安装的话是二进制安装:sudoapt-getinstall-kinetic-usb-cam源码安装:mkdir-pcatkin_ws/srccdcatkin_ws/srcgitclonehttps://github.com/bosch-ros-pkg/usb_cam.gitusb_camcd..catkin_makesourcedevel/setup.bash我这

《安富莱嵌入式周报》第315期:开源USB高速分析仪,8GHz示波器开发, 600行C编写RISC-V内核,英特尔推出用于开发人员等宽字体,便携物联网监测器

周报汇总地址:嵌入式周报-uCOS&uCGUI&emWin&embOS&TouchGFX&ThreadX-硬汉嵌入式论坛-PoweredbyDiscuz! 视频版:https://www.bilibili.com/video/BV1gV4y117UD/《安富莱嵌入式周报》第315期:开源USB高速分析仪,8GHz示波器开发,600行C编写RISC-V内核,英特尔推出用于开发人员等宽字体,便携物联网监测器1、开源USB2.0高速分析仪GitHub-ataradov/usb-sniffer:Low-costLS/FS/HSUSBsnifferwithWiresharkinterfaceusb-sn

USB Audio Class (UAC)音频解读规范

前言USB音频非常流行,原因之一是USBAudio是USB标准的一部分,因此原生模式驱动程序可用于所有流程的操作系统(WinLinuxMac)。USB音频是一种灵活的解决方案,因为任何PC都提供USB接口。提示:以下是本篇文章正文内容一、USBAudioClass?USBAudioClass,USB音频类,一个像USB这样的通用数据接口,可以有很多种实现数字音频数据传输的方式。不同的开发者可以根据自己的喜好和需求,定义任意的控制方式,传输模式,音频格式等等参数。USB非常适合作为以PC为平台的音频(包括语音和音乐等)传输协议,而基于PC的电话系统从一开始就是USB接口发展的重要考量和推动力。从

USB Audio Class (UAC)音频解读规范

前言USB音频非常流行,原因之一是USBAudio是USB标准的一部分,因此原生模式驱动程序可用于所有流程的操作系统(WinLinuxMac)。USB音频是一种灵活的解决方案,因为任何PC都提供USB接口。提示:以下是本篇文章正文内容一、USBAudioClass?USBAudioClass,USB音频类,一个像USB这样的通用数据接口,可以有很多种实现数字音频数据传输的方式。不同的开发者可以根据自己的喜好和需求,定义任意的控制方式,传输模式,音频格式等等参数。USB非常适合作为以PC为平台的音频(包括语音和音乐等)传输协议,而基于PC的电话系统从一开始就是USB接口发展的重要考量和推动力。从

JeTSON Xavier NX TX2_NX 暗转yolov5 v6.2使用Tensorrt加速实现USB摄像头和CSI摄像头的目标识别及采坑记录

本文是参考各位博客朋友的笔记做了实操整理勿喷。硬件设备nvidiaJETSONNXTX2_NX 软件版本BSP3273(Jetpack4.6.3)再次分享一下刷机指导JetsonLinuxR32.7.3NVIDIA®JetsonLinux驱动程序包是Jetson™的主板支持包。它包括Linux内核,UEFI引导加载程序,NVIDIA驱动程序,闪存实用程序,基于Ubuntu的示例文件系统以及Jetson平台的更多内容。NVIDIAJetsonLinux32.7.3JetsonLinux32.7.3是JetsonLinux32.7.1之上的次要版本,包含安全修复。其余功能与JetsonLinux3

数字电路硬件设计系列(十二)之USB电路设计

针对设计过程中的问题,如有疑问,欢迎留言评论!点我返回目录1简介USB电路,在我们的平时的应用十分的广泛,常见的鼠标,键盘、显示屏的触摸功能等,对外的接口均使用的是USB接口。USB接口主要可以划分为两种:USB2.0、USB3.0。从连接器上区分的依据是,内部颜色白色的为USB2.0接口,内部颜色为蓝色的为USB3.0接口(当然也不是绝对是这样的)。详情见图:2电路设计2.1USB2.0电路设计USB2.0主要有4个引脚:分别是VCC、GND、D+、D-。见下图:很明显,其中多了一个ID的引脚,这个引脚用于区分是Host还是Peripheral:Host:连接到GNDPeripheral:浮